Jacksonville clinic owner charged with fraud and racketeering

A Jacksonville clinic owner is at the center of a statewide fraud and racketeering investigation.

The Florida Department of Financial Services has arrested Sandy Morales for charges relating to a fraud scam that resulted in at least $100,000 in false billing. Jail records show the charges include conspiracy to commit and intentional motor vehicle crash, organized fraud, and violation of racketeering laws.

Investigators say Morales staged multiple car crashes and paid people to pose as passengers and seek treatment for their fake injuries in his clinic, Gate Parkway Diagnostic Center.  The DFS further claims Morales recruited other clinic owners to be a part of scheme.

He faces up to 45 years in prison and is currently being held in jail on a bond over $600,000.

DFS says more than 180 arrests have already been linked to this fraud network since September 2012.
